Pre and Post Operative Nursing Considerations for Specific Surgical CasesSurgical nursing can be extremely rewarding and having a better understanding of the surgical procedures we are dealing with allows us to implement specific nursing care that can help the patient throughout the whole perioperative period.In this course, we will start from the very beginning looking at how to gain relevant information at admit, how extra details and consideration of the patients handling and environment can aid in reducing pre-and post-operative stress.
